What companies run services between Arnold Road, Greater London, England and Butlins Bognor Regis, England?

There is no direct connection from Arnold Road to Butlins Bognor Regis. However, you can walk to Dagenham Heathway station, take the subway to Victoria station, walk to London Victoria, take the train to Barnham, take the train to Bognor Regis, then walk to Butlins Bognor Regis. Alternatively, you can drive from Arnold Road to Butlins Bognor Regis in around 1h 44m.
